Li-Guo Dong is a scholar working on Civil and Structural Engineering, Building and Construction and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Li-Guo Dong has authored 25 papers receiving a total of 395 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 24 papers in Civil and Structural Engineering, 21 papers in Building and Construction and 8 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Li-Guo Dong's work include Structural Behavior of Reinforced Concrete (21 papers), Concrete Corrosion and Durability (19 papers) and Corrosion Behavior and Inhibition (8 papers). Li-Guo Dong is often cited by papers focused on Structural Behavior of Reinforced Concrete (21 papers), Concrete Corrosion and Durability (19 papers) and Corrosion Behavior and Inhibition (8 papers). Li-Guo Dong collaborates with scholars based in China, New Zealand and Hong Kong. Li-Guo Dong's co-authors include Shansuo Zheng, Lu Feng Yang, Yixin Zhang, Yixin Zhang, Kuangyu Dai, Lei Li, Yongna Jia, Yi Yang, Xiaoyu Zhang and Yibo Zhang and has published in prestigious journals such as Construction and Building Materials, RSC Advances and Engineering Structures.
